About This Property
This 2,420 sq ft renovated brick home with hardwood & tile floors is available for rent now in the Crieve Hall area. Fabulous floor plan with an in-law suite or office area in the finished basement. Incredible patio and fenced in backyard. Zoned for Crieve Hall Elementary. Utilities would be in renter's name. 6-12 months rent contract available. Prefer rent contract to end or renew during busy rental season (May-August). * Bedrooms: 5 * Bathrooms: 3 * 2,420 sq ft * Year built: 1959 * Heating: Forced air, Gas * Cooling: Central * Parking: Off-street * Lot: 0.39 Acres Appliances included: Dishwasher, Microwave, Range / Oven, Refrigerator, Washer & Dryer. No smoking & no use of fireplace Deposits: House deposit=1 month rent, Pet deposit=$500 Pet monthly rent= $25 per pet Application fee is $50 per applicant/family

Nashville, also known as Music City, is the capital of Tennessee. Often heralded as a center for country music, Nashville has also become a hub for various other genres such as bluegrass, jazz, classical, pop, soul, rock, gospel, and Americana. Renowned music venues in Nashville include the Ryman Auditorium, the Grand Ole Opry, Bridgestone Arena, and several honky-tonk bars on Broadway.
Touting big-city amenities while maintaining a small-town feel, Nashville offers residents and visitors access to a wide range of attractions. If you choose to rent in Nashville, you will have the chance to visit the Nashville Zoo at Grassmere, check out the latest exhibit at the Frist Center for the Visual Arts, see the Parthenon at Centennial Park, tour the Country Music Hall of Fame, catch a performance at the Tennessee Performing Arts Center, watch the Tennessee Titans score touchdowns at Nissan Stadium, and bask in stunning riverfront views at Cumberland Park.
